Transaction efdb764d92ac596c546ae0499e99efc0ed2d1ed15a1183d9e575e8f8091dec99

3 Input
2 Outputs
  • efdb764d92ac596c546ae0499e99efc0ed2d1ed15a1183d9e575e8f8091dec99:0
  • value  881763
    address  3JjdcXJm5bL8gmppdoBwjJPaiWdiwMEVaz
  • efdb764d92ac596c546ae0499e99efc0ed2d1ed15a1183d9e575e8f8091dec99:1
  • value  7495475
    address  32PtshWMeJFgCAMLEdFvgVXyiDu2onx6qZ